Practical Design Notes for Brand Creators
As a brand designer, I recommend testing this awareness ribbon symbol set with your brand color palette to ensure it blends seamlessly. Check how it looks in black and white to confirm its versatility across different mediums. Place it inside real campaign mockups to see how it integrates with other design assets. Preview it on mobile screens to ensure it remains legible at smaller sizes.
Compare it against competitor visuals to gauge its uniqueness and relevance. Test how it pairs with serif, sans-serif, script, and display fonts to find the best combinations for your brand voice. Review spacing and balance to maintain a clean and professional appearance. Lastly, always confirm the commercial license before using it in paid campaigns, client work, or business branding to avoid legal issues.
